Hey — handing over the Striderly chip-reader work. The mat readers at the Fennbrook course drop reads when two runners cross within 40ms, so we added a dedup buffer; it's in staging, not prod. Watch the auth on the reader-to-gateway channel — it's still a shared secret, which I know you'll flag. Firmware flashing steps and the pairing checklist are in the handover doc. Everything, including the threat notes you asked about, is collected on the internal page here.

runbook for tafof-yawif: https://confluence.tolvaqsys.internal/display/display/browse/pages/7be3

Finance Review Summary — Customer Concentration

For branch managers: the Q3 review confirms that Brynhall Logistics now accounts for 38% of group revenue, up from 29% last year. Margins on the account remain healthy, but any contract disruption would materially affect cash flow at the Ostendale and Ferrow branches. Finance recommends diversification targets per branch, to be set at the November planning session. The related confidential direction follows below.

management briefing: Headcount on the Quenael team goes from 9 to 80 by the end of July. Gross margin on Quenael came in at 15 percent against a plan of 20 percent.

// Heads up for security review: the Chronopole client signs requests
// with a timestamp, and our build agents in the Velter farm drift
// by up to 90 seconds. We widened the skew window to 120s rather
// than fixing NTP everywhere (sorry). Revisit once the agents get
// re-imaged. The client authenticates against the skew service
// using the key below.

service key, fawip-bajef: kto11_Qt5wZK9vdNC

MEMO — Finance Team

Following the annual count at the Hallowick depot, we will record an inventory write-down on the Seabright accessory range. Obsolescence and water damage account for most of the adjustment; the remainder is shrinkage under investigation. Tomas Vell will post the entries before period close and update the provision methodology accordingly. Auditors have been notified informally. Please route any queries through Tomas rather than the depot. The confidential business implications are set out below.

confidential, kagup-bafog: Fraaxax Group is in early talks to buy Soroxox Group for about $343.8 million. The Olidor launch date is June 14, and nothing goes to the press before then. Legal wants the Aldmirek Logistics term sheet signed before July 23.